BRO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

872 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Brown & Brown (BRO)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$21.9B — up 0.98% from $21.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 126 funds opened new BRO posit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 65 holders — while 339 added to existing stakes and 270 trimmed.

The largest buyer was First Trust Advisors, adding an estimated $216M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$200M.
